Class Action GM Eight-Speed Transmission Lawsuit Hits A Snag

The article claims that this is GM’s defense:

GM has argued that these claims should be thrown out, as its express warranty only covers defects that relate to materials and workmanship, and not design defects. The suits claim that all 8L45E and 8L90E transmissions experience these problems, which implies the problems are related to a design defect instead, the automaker said.

According to the article, GM expressly admitted to the 8Lxx having design defects that are capable of causing the complaints in the action, which is very significant.

From this point on it's a matter of warranty coverage interpretation, which a good class action lawyer should have a field day with. Unless the warranty specifically excludes design defects (the legality of which is already questionable), I'm sure there are a million precedents of implied design defect coverage.

Even looking at it from a common sense point of view, the first question the judge needs to ask when hearing this defense is "whose name is on the design documents, patents and trademarks?", "GM? well, then GM are the party responsible for the adequacy of said designs to their stated purpose".

The Takata airbag example is a good parallel, too, and there are many others, tires, fuel tanks etc.
